What Aluminum Siding Oxidation Does Before Peeling Starts

Aluminum siding oxidation is one of the most important issues to understand before repainting. It starts when aluminum reacts with oxygen in the air. Over time, this reaction creates a dull, chalky layer on the surface. That layer can affect how the siding looks and how well a new coating can bond.

The first warning sign is often simple. Someone touches the siding and a white residue comes off on their hand. That residue is not just dirt. It is a sign that the surface has changed. The siding may also look faded, uneven, washed out, or older than the rest of the property.

This is where many coating problems begin. If the chalky layer remains on the siding, new paint has to bond to residue instead of the actual prepared surface. That weak bond can lead to peeling, flaking, uneven colour, and a shorter coating life.

These warning signs should not be ignored. Faded or dull appearance, white chalk residue, reduced paint adhesion, and uneven colour after coating all point to a surface that needs proper preparation before repainting. How to Prepare Oxidized Aluminum Siding Before Painting

The preparation process should be practical, careful, and complete. It should not begin with a paint tray. It should begin with the surface.

Commercial and industrial buildings often have large siding areas exposed to different conditions. One side of the building may face stronger sunlight. Another side may collect more moisture. Loading areas, roof lines, vents, and shaded walls can also age differently. That means oxidized aluminum siding should be checked across the full building, not only in one visible area.

A quick rinse is not enough when chalky residue remains. Pressure washing can remove loose dirt and surface buildup, but oxidation often needs more attention. The surface may need cleaning solutions suited for aluminum, light abrasion or brushing for stubborn residue, and thorough rinsing so the coating does not bond to dust, chalk, old residue, or contaminants.

This is where oxidation control before painting aluminum and metal siding becomes important. Skipped or rushed preparation can reduce coating performance and create uneven finishes later.

The goal is simple. The surface should be clean enough for primer and paint to bond to the siding itself, not to the residue sitting on top of it.

Cleaning, Drying, Masking, and Priming Steps

Once oxidation has been removed, the surface still needs final preparation. The wall should be fully rinsed so cleaning solution and residue do not remain. It should also dry completely before coating. Moisture left behind can interfere with adhesion and finish quality.

Professional preparation for oxidized aluminum siding should include:

  • Checking that the surface is dry before application
  • Masking nearby areas to control overspray
  • Inspecting seams, joints, and fasteners for damage
  • Applying primers formulated for metal surfaces

How to Choose the Best Paint for Aluminum Siding Without Guesswork

Choosing the best paint for aluminum siding starts with the building, not the colour chart.

A coating that works well on one property may not be the right fit for another. Surface condition, weather exposure, colour choice, existing coating wear, and maintenance goals all affect the decision. If the siding has chalking, fading, old coating failure, or active oxidation, paint selection should come after preparation planning.

Paint cannot make up for poor cleaning. It cannot correct weak primer selection. It also cannot bond properly if chalky residue is still sitting on the siding.

Start with the surface. Is it clean? Is it dry? Is the old coating still bonded? Is oxidation present? Has the siding been rinsed properly after cleaning? These questions matter before primer or topcoat is selected.

Then look at exposure. Commercial and industrial buildings deal with sun, rain, wind, moisture, and seasonal temperature changes. Some walls absorb more heat. Some colours show fading faster. Some areas face more moisture because of shade, roof lines, vents, or loading areas. Aluminum can also expand and contract as temperatures change, so coating flexibility matters.

That is why coating selection should not be treated like a standard exterior paint decision. It should connect to surface preparation, primer compatibility, coating flexibility, colour retention, gloss expectations, UV exposure, and moisture resistance.

Acrylic latex coatings are often used for aluminum siding because they offer flexibility and weather resistance. Epoxy primers may support adhesion on prepared metal surfaces. Urethane topcoats may help where UV resistance and finish durability are important. The right system depends on the condition of the siding and the exposure around the building.

Primer, Topcoat, UV, Moisture, and Colour Factors

Primer and topcoat need to work together. Primer helps the coating bond to the prepared metal surface. The topcoat protects the finish from weather exposure, colour loss, moisture, and daily wear.

Dark colours need extra attention because they can absorb more heat during the day. That can make fading more noticeable, especially on sun exposed walls. Moisture also matters. Areas near roof lines, shaded walls, vents, or loading zones may need closer review before coating begins.

For commercial and industrial properties, this is not only about appearance. It is about reducing the chance of early cracking, fading, peeling, and repainting disruption. The right plan connects preparation, primer, coating flexibility, colour choice, and application conditions.

How to Keep the Finish Performing Longer

A longer lasting finish starts before the paint is applied. Cleaning, oxidation removal, drying, primer selection, coating compatibility, colour choice, and application conditions all affect the final result.

After aluminum siding painting, the building should not be ignored until the next major repaint. Exposed walls, shaded areas, loading zones, seams, fasteners, and high sun areas should be reviewed over time. Watch for fading, chalky residue, cracking, peeling, dull colour, and adhesion loss.

Aluminum siding also expands and contracts with temperature changes, so coating flexibility matters. Sun, rain, moisture, and weather exposure can wear down the finish over time. Darker colours may also show fading more clearly on heat exposed areas.
